Final IRS Regs Will Impact ACA Filings for Small Employers

"Employers that file at least ten returns during the calendar year must file their ACA returns electronically, beginning with returns required to be filed during 2024. The final regulations require employers to aggregate most information returns, such as Form W-2 and 1099, to determine if they meet the ten-return threshold for mandatory electronic filing."  MORE >>

Agencies Provide Guidance on 'No Gag Clause' Rule for Group Health Plans and New Reporting Requirements

"The first attestation is due December 31, 2023.... Employers with self-insured health plans should negotiate and enter into an agreement with their TPA to provide the attestation on the plan's behalf. Employers with fully insured plans should coordinate with the insurer and confirm in writing that the insurer will submit the attestation on the plan's behalf."  MORE >>

Is Telehealth Really Saving Money for Employers?

"A recent survey ... found that 53 percent of employers and plans believe virtual care is a principal means of improving patient care and outcomes.... Employees now see telehealth as a 'must-have' versus a 'nice-to-have' benefit,  ... When evaluating their own expenses, companies should look at both short- and long-term costs[.]"  MORE >>

Most Accountholders Are Not Taking Full Advantage of HSA Benefits (PDF)

"[M]ost accountholders use their HSAs to pay for current expenses ... The average accountholder has a modest balance, contributes far less than the maximum and does not invest their HSA. However, the longer someone owned an HSA, their balance tends to be larger, contributions tend to be higher, and they are more likely they are to invest their HSA in assets other than cash."  MORE >>

Courts Should Follow Eighth Circuit on ERISA Procedure Rules

"By not falling into the trap of looking at [this] case as an administrative law claim, the Eighth Circuit has added yet another voice to the growing effort to restore regular civil procedure to ERISA cases. Other courts should take note and continue to question and ultimately bring an end to procedures that have no place in ERISA litigation." [Yates v. Symetra Life Insurance Company, No. 22-1093 (8th Cir. Feb. 23, 2023)]  MORE >>
